From 0f30cbf26e66bd5eb186a827e9c7ca33c9e0c249 Mon Sep 17 00:00:00 2001 From: Hans-Christoph Steiner Date: Tue, 10 Apr 2007 03:37:54 +0000 Subject: object to see the mouse pointer position in patch coords svn path=/trunk/externals/hcs/; revision=7552 --- pointer_position.pd | 65 +++++++++++++++++++++++++++++++++++++++++++++++++++++ 1 file changed, 65 insertions(+) create mode 100644 pointer_position.pd (limited to 'pointer_position.pd') diff --git a/pointer_position.pd b/pointer_position.pd new file mode 100644 index 0000000..8fe501b --- /dev/null +++ b/pointer_position.pd @@ -0,0 +1,65 @@ +#N canvas 641 119 499 478 10; +#X obj 99 201 cnv 15 50 18 empty \$0-Y 169) 3 11 0 16 -233017 -1 0 +; +#X obj 51 201 cnv 15 50 18 empty \$0-X (212 3 11 0 16 -233017 -1 0 +; +#X msg 325 357 label \$1; +#X obj 325 381 send \$0-Y; +#X obj 325 333 zexy/makesymbol %s); +#X obj 229 296 unpack float float float; +#X msg 195 357 label \$1; +#X obj 195 333 zexy/makesymbol (%s; +#X obj 195 381 send \$0-X; +#X obj 124 6 inlet; +#X obj 124 104 select 0; +#X obj 124 31 route float bang; +#X obj 229 221 cyclone/gate 2; +#N canvas 0 22 454 304 capture 0; +#X obj 216 104 loadbang; +#X obj 250 191 route motion; +#X obj 188 169 toxy/tot .parent; +#X msg 188 148 capture \$1; +#X msg 188 127 1; +#X msg 124 127 0; +#X obj 102 46 inlet; +#X obj 197 46 inlet; +#X obj 250 227 outlet; +#X obj 197 67 bang; +#X obj 102 70 bang; +#X connect 0 0 4 0; +#X connect 1 0 8 0; +#X connect 2 2 1 0; +#X connect 3 0 2 0; +#X connect 4 0 3 0; +#X connect 5 0 3 0; +#X connect 6 0 10 0; +#X connect 7 0 9 0; +#X connect 9 0 4 0; +#X connect 10 0 5 0; +#X restore 165 159 pd capture motion; +#X obj 124 83 trigger float bang; +#X msg 229 104 1; +#X obj 264 83 trigger bang bang; +#X msg 363 103 2; +#X connect 2 0 3 0; +#X connect 4 0 2 0; +#X connect 5 0 7 0; +#X connect 5 1 4 0; +#X connect 6 0 8 0; +#X connect 7 0 6 0; +#X connect 9 0 11 0; +#X connect 10 0 13 0; +#X connect 10 1 13 1; +#X connect 11 0 14 0; +#X connect 11 1 16 0; +#X connect 12 0 5 0; +#X connect 12 1 13 0; +#X connect 12 1 5 0; +#X connect 13 0 12 1; +#X connect 14 0 10 0; +#X connect 14 1 15 0; +#X connect 15 0 12 0; +#X connect 16 0 13 1; +#X connect 16 1 17 0; +#X connect 17 0 12 0; +#X coords 0 -1 1 1 100 20 1 50 200; -- cgit v1.2.1